Onion Soup

Chop onions into black sauce pan.
Smell wavers up, nostrils expand.

Some like topped with bread, cheese.
Tasty without. Goes down with ease.

Beef broth hits the spot, it's hot.

We're having it with BLTs and fries.
I rinsed the onions and I didn't cry.

Soup's simmering on stove for dinner.
It smells so good, sure to be a winner.
